    F225 4-stroke on Ranger boat?

    OK, I know you lucky guys with 100% pure ranger bass boats read the topic title, dropped your coffee mug and hesitated to click on the link for fear of what you might read but here is the deal.... I have a 210 Ranger Reata (family comprimize - at least I got one )

    Having had unresolved issues with my 225 OX66 , Yamaha is finally working with me directly . An option suggested was to hang an F225 4stroke on my boat .

    I am concidoring the F225 4-stoke for my 210 Ranger Reata. Yamaha says it will require a jackplate due to the design of the transom and the F225's 25" shaft length which is 5" longer than the OX66.

    Any thoughts on gains or losses with this setup - F225 with Jackplate?

    Re: F225 4-stroke on Ranger boat? (BuzzB8)

    My thought...It is going to look funny as heck with that motor cowl sitting 5" higher than your current motor since the F225 only comes as a 25". Look at how your motor sits now. Imagine the top of the cowl now 5" higher, do you think it will be in the way? Might also upset the balance of the boat with that much motor sitting that much higher on the transom.
